Output 08b7895e92f6b536b29bb6164e5d72c01b6b6e6f528261877bd8ce41fbcc8937:9

value
104839586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 434b8763aeb1c592a115da2e1b5f4788ecf59ff8 OP_EQUAL
address
ME2yz7w7n4RCkuD2HZH4LDXymBBx9xhChS
transaction
08b7895e92f6b536b29bb6164e5d72c01b6b6e6f528261877bd8ce41fbcc8937
spent
true